Need help making a DVD from an avi file
I need some help. Here's what I'm trying to do: I'm attempting to take an avi file that has a display aspect ratio of 2.444 and write it to a dvd and play in that aspect ratio. So the program needs to fill the difference with black on top and bottom so it will fit on a tv screen.
The problem I'm having is that everytime I convert/write this file I end up with a stretched picture. I've tried using sony dvd architect, nero, ulead video studio 9 and a few other programs. Can anyone recommend a program or method to fix this? I can burn the dvd fine and make it playable I just need some help sorting out the problem with the aspect ratio. Thanks in advance
